We are seeking an Education Facilities Analyst to support the Community Facilities Planner in strategic
planning for education facilities. You will engage in planning for education facilities in 3 main areas:
- In the City’s Ten-Year Capital Strategy and in supporting the School Construction Authority’s Capital Plan
- In neighborhood planning efforts led by DCP’s borough offices
- In analyzing the local impact of development proposals to the City Planning Commission
Your role will be particularly focused on equity, including ensuring that neighborhoods with overcrowded schools, lack of available sites, future expected growth, and/or lower income levels are getting the education facilities needed. This will require a deep understanding of broader planning factors including population growth, demographic shifts, and housing trends.
You will be expected to collaborate with a wide range of subject matter experts. You will work closely with multiple divisions at DCP (including the five borough offices; Population; Housing, Economic, and Infrastructure Planning; Environmental Assessment and Review; Counsel; and Information & Technology), with other agencies (especially the School Construction Authority and the Department of Education), and with City Hall.
